Transaction 53be107a499a674b63ca21515b3b768450ac21ed06ed5bd2e25a14ac72ec51b5

1 Input
2 Outputs
  • 53be107a499a674b63ca21515b3b768450ac21ed06ed5bd2e25a14ac72ec51b5:0
  • value  1704681
    address  17RLacjxmXn2r3LXMHopUEwVeAVrJ2yNc6
  • 53be107a499a674b63ca21515b3b768450ac21ed06ed5bd2e25a14ac72ec51b5:1
  • value  15653780
    address  12KFYnxnPRgHyn47415iLZx5sG7YQZDSaD